  Televisie, tegnopolie en postmodernisme
 
 
Title: Televisie, tegnopolie en postmodernisme
Author: Fourie, Pieter
Appeared in: Communicatio
Paging: Volume 19 (1993) nr. 1 pages 2-13
Year: 1993
Contents: In this article the author argues that the ongoing process of redefining public broadcasting can be related to the nature of the technopological society of the late twentieth century and the existing postmodern condition. In this society the emphasis moved away from television as a cultural product to television as a consumer product or commodity. Based on Neil Postman's work he briefly discusses the nature of the technopological society and its influence on public communication. He relates this to postmodernism and briefly discusses the so-called postmodern condition and how it is reflected (and even created) by and through television.
